Hurricane season occurs from June 1st through November 30th in the North Atlantic Ocean. Should a threat of a hurricane or tropical storm happen, it is always best practice to prepare for the risks to keep you and your loved safe.

Prior to the storm, please take the following precautions:

  • Have a battery-operated radio on hand so you can keep updated on the most current conditions.
  • Clear off your balcony.
  • Place rolled up towels at the bottom of exterior doors and windows to limit wind-born rain intrusion.
  • Purchase enough food and other provisions to last for at least 2-3 days. An ice chest filled with ice is a good idea in the event power is lost for an extended period of time.
  • Especially in ground floor units, remove computers, televisions, and other valuable items off of the floor. In all units, remove these items from the vicinity of exterior doors and windows.
  • Make sure your renters insurance policy is paid and up to date. Take a written inventory of your valuable possessions, and take pictures of them. If you do not have renters insurance, it is unlikely you will be able to purchase it until after the storm passes.

During the storm:

  • Continue to stay updated on current and expected weather conditions.
  • Stay indoors! Even if the rain lets up and you must go outside, exercise extreme caution. Do not wade into deep water as hidden hazards may be present.
  • If power is lost during the storm, make sure all burners on your stove are in the ‘off’ position prior to restoration of service.

After the storm:

  • Use extreme caution while walking outdoors.
  • Wipe up as much water as you can that has seeped in under doors and windows.
  • Notify the office as soon as possible if you have water intrusion in your unit.
  • Notify your insurance carrier in the event you have sustained damage.
  • The office staff will begin clean up as soon as it is safe to do so.

Be honest- When was the last time you thought about cleaning your dryer vents? 

The reality is, most people simply forget about cleaning their dryer vents, while some do not even know where they are located! While you may never give your dryer vents a second thought, it is important to clean and maintain these vents on a regular basis. Lint and other debris can building in your dryer vents, reducing air flow to the dryer, backing up dryer exhaust gases and, in turn, create a fire hazard in your home. According to the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ission, more than 15,000 fires are sparked every year by clothes dryers.

Signs Your Dryer Vent Needs to be Cleaned

Most noticable sign that you may have a clog in your dryer vent is when your dryer stops drying your clothes in one cycle. If the heat and moisure can't escape through the vent, the dryer keeps working, in attempt to dry them. As your dryer works harder and heat continues to build up in the drum, this can lead to a dryer vent fire. Other signs include:

  • Drying time is in excess of 35-40 minutes
  • Musty odor in clothing following the drying cycle
  • Clothes are unusually hot to the touch upon removing from the drum.
  • Dryer vent hood flap does not properly open as it is designed.
  • Debris is noticed within the ourside of the dryer vent opening.
  • Excessive heat is noticed in the room while dryer during operation.
  • Large amounts of lint accumulate in lint trap during operation.
  • Visable sign of lint and debris is noticed around the lint filter.
  • Excessive odor from dryer sheets used during operation.

Cleaning Your Vents

There are several DIY articles online that show you how to clean out your vents. Before you do anything make sure the dryer is unplugged! If you are not comfortable in doing so, it is always best to leave it to the professionals and contact a local appliance specialist.

If it's been a while since you've last cleaned your dryer vents, please take a moment and clean them our today!
